Mozilla's got a new jacket

And it's bolder, brighter and better. Why?

The masses need info short, fast and to the point. The old design, and Firefox's page in particular, was wordy and confusing for new users. IE plays for the masses, and to get the masses back, Mozilla needs to do the same.

The KISS method was required -- and as usual, Mozilla and its band of supporters have stepped up quickly to the task, making the necessary changes and getting the product out for all to learn about and enjoy. The new site is clean, fast-loading and full of the latest information in easy-to-read bullet-point form, enabling visitors to find exactly what they're looking for super-quick.
